Activate Your Potential with the Myers-Briggs Type Indicator

Understanding your internal wiring is the first step, and few tools are as famous for this as the MBTI.

The MBTI sorts personality into sixteen distinct types based on declared preferences for how you perceive information and how you make decisions — it measures self-reported preferences, not observed behaviors or actual decision-making patterns. This helps identify preferred workplace environments.

Identify Your Top Talents with CliftonStrengths by Gallup

While MBTI looks at type, Gallup focuses on your specific competitive advantages.

This assessment identifies your top five talent themes. It encourages building on strengths rather than fixing weaknesses. This approach boosts professional confidence quickly.

Focus on these four core domains to master your career trajectory:

  • Strategic Thinking themes
  • Relationship Building themes
  • Influencing themes
  • Executing themes

Use these themes to describe your unique value proposition. They provide a common language for performance reviews and growth.

Match Your Interests with the Strong Interest Inventory

Knowing what you are good at is vital, but you also need to enjoy the work itself.

This inventory compares your interests to those of satisfied professionals. It provides scores across the six RIASEC codes and a Theme Code based on the three strongest interest areas. It reveals hidden career paths.

Harness Machine Learning Insights via Pymetrics Cognitive Games

Modern career matching now uses neuroscience and algorithms to remove human bias.

Pymetrics uses cognitive games to measure traits like risk tolerance. Machine learning then matches your profile to top performers. It is a data-driven approach.
